M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Filtrar datas/Contar registros

    avatar
    ELIEZER frança
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 30
    Registrado : 04/12/2014

    [Resolvido]Filtrar datas/Contar registros Empty [Resolvido]Filtrar datas/Contar registros

    Mensagem  ELIEZER frança 5/12/2014, 01:01

    Boa noite, sou leigo em access mas estou montando aqui um formulário (form. erro_leitura) de cadastro de erros de leitura (são leituras feitas por leituristas em uma empresa de energia elétrica) nesse cadastro inclui matricula e data em que foi cadastrado dentre outros campos, fiz nesse formulário uma caixa de texto de datainicial e datafinal, fiz uma consulta para filtrar entre datas e outra consulta para contar a quantidade de erros de leitura de cada matricula entre as datas que eu filtrar. Consegui fazer isso só que as vezes filtra correto as datas e outras vezes não filtra, as vezes conta certo a quantidade de erros outras não.

    Queria uma ajuda segue em anexo o bd.

    desde já agradeço
    Anexos
    [Resolvido]Filtrar datas/Contar registros AttachmentBD.zip
    Você não tem permissão para fazer download dos arquivos anexados.
    (351 Kb) Baixado 42 vez(es)


    Última edição por ELIEZER frança em 5/12/2014, 01:40, editado 1 vez(es)
    Marcelo David
    Marcelo David
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3873
    Registrado : 21/04/2011

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  Marcelo David 5/12/2014, 01:17

    REGRAS DO FÓRUM

    1. Tenha paciência com quem coloca aqui as suas duvidas.
    2. Clareza nos títulos dos tópicos e duvidas, evite a linguagem MSN.
    3. Não colocar diversas vezes a mesma dúvida.
    4. Explicar detalhadamente o problema e informar a versão do seu Office + Sistema Operativo.
    5. Retorne sempre se deu certo, esse retorno é muito importante.
    6. Respeite toda a equipe Staff e demais membros deste fórum.
    7. Use sempre o botão Busca, sempre que tiver uma dúvida e antes de abrir tópicos.
    8. Não usar palavras como "Urgente". O fórum é livre e ninguém é obrigado a responder com urgência.
    9. A publicidade é proíbida e só pode ser feita pelo Administrador ou depois de aprovada pelo Administrador.
    10. Se o seu tópico não for respondido, tem o direito de fazer um Up ao final de 24horas!
    11. A colocação de Códigos ou Exemplos, devem constar sempre os créditos de quem o elaborou.
    12. Fale, não GRITE! Só letras Maiúsculas, na Internet é o mesmo que gritar!
    13. É proibido tirar duvidas nas Salas de Repositório, devem abrir um novo tópico nas salas de duvidas, relacionando o Exemplo em causa.


    Por gentileza, corrija o título e sua postagem.


    .................................................................................
    Aprenda como criar formulário desacoplado.
    Conheça meu canal no Youtube e se inscreva.
    [Resolvido]Filtrar datas/Contar registros Marcel11
    Marcelo David
    Marcelo David
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3873
    Registrado : 21/04/2011

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  Marcelo David 5/12/2014, 01:55

    Nos forneça mais detalhes, como o nome do formulário que tem os controles que fazem
    a filtragem, os nomes dos controles, como você determina que é uma leitura errada, usuário
    e senha, etc...

    Aguardamos.


    .................................................................................
    Aprenda como criar formulário desacoplado.
    Conheça meu canal no Youtube e se inscreva.
    [Resolvido]Filtrar datas/Contar registros Marcel11
    avatar
    ELIEZER frança
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 30
    Registrado : 04/12/2014

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  ELIEZER frança 5/12/2014, 02:08

    Desculpe esqueci de tirar as senhas, usuario=gbs, senha=batman, senha do vb=batman1
    Entao o nome do formulario é ERRO_LEITURA, a consulta ERRO_MATRICULAS eu coloquei o criterio pra filtrar entre datas, ai fiz outra consulta com o nome ERRO_FINAL, para contar as matriculas e me mostrar a quantidade. todos os lançamentos nesse formulario ja são leituras errada não é o programa que determina.

    Então essas consultas que fiz as vezes me volta a contagem errada, testa ai, principalmente quando eu coloco uma data muito anterior do cadastro da primeira leitura.
    Marcelo David
    Marcelo David
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3873
    Registrado : 21/04/2011

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  Marcelo David 5/12/2014, 02:44

    Observei que na tabela Erro_Leitura existem registros que não tem datas. Esses registros
    não iram satisfazer o critério que o excluirá dos resultados. Pode ser que seja esse o erro.
    Um outro detalhes é que nessa mesma tabela, o campo Data é do tipo texto só que o mais
    indicado é do tipo data, pois se trata de uma data. Outro detalhe é que o nome do campo data
    na tabela Erro_Leitura não pode conter o nome "Data", pois essa é uma palavra reservada do access
    usado em alguns funções. Sendo assim, mude o nome do campo.

    Teste as observações que indiquei e nos retorno por favor.



    .................................................................................
    Aprenda como criar formulário desacoplado.
    Conheça meu canal no Youtube e se inscreva.
    [Resolvido]Filtrar datas/Contar registros Marcel11
    avatar
    ELIEZER frança
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 30
    Registrado : 04/12/2014

    [Resolvido]Filtrar datas/Contar registros Empty Filtrar datas/Contar registros

    Mensagem  ELIEZER frança 6/12/2014, 09:10

    Muito obrigado Marcelo, deu tudo certo aqui, funcionou perfeitamente.
    Que código eu coloco no formulário para que os registros não sejam salvos sem a data?

    obrigado
    Marcelo David
    Marcelo David
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3873
    Registrado : 21/04/2011

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  Marcelo David 6/12/2014, 19:57

    No evento antes de atualizar do formulário que grava os erros
    de leitura:

       If IsNull(Me.Texto24) Then
              MsgBox "O preenchimento da data é obrigatório!", vbExclamation,"Dados obrigatório"
              Me.Texto24.SetFocus
              Cancel = True
       End If


    Última edição por Marcelo David em 6/12/2014, 22:42, editado 1 vez(es)


    .................................................................................
    Aprenda como criar formulário desacoplado.
    Conheça meu canal no Youtube e se inscreva.
    [Resolvido]Filtrar datas/Contar registros Marcel11
    avatar
    ELIEZER frança
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 30
    Registrado : 04/12/2014

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  ELIEZER frança 6/12/2014, 22:32

    Boa noite Marcelo, agora esta pronto meu formulário.

    Você é craque nisso heim, parabens.

    Muito obrigado pela ajuda
    Marcelo David
    Marcelo David
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 3873
    Registrado : 21/04/2011

    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  Marcelo David 6/12/2014, 22:40

    Grato pelo retorno Very Happy


    .................................................................................
    Aprenda como criar formulário desacoplado.
    Conheça meu canal no Youtube e se inscreva.
    [Resolvido]Filtrar datas/Contar registros Marcel11

    Conteúdo patrocinado


    [Resolvido]Filtrar datas/Contar registros Empty Re: [Resolvido]Filtrar datas/Contar registros

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 6/5/2024, 13:39